History & Origin
Qamar is Arabic for 'the moon,' a bright, poetic name used across Arabic cultures (sometimes unisex), here for a boy. Rare in the U.S. (said 'kuh-MAR').
It appears rarely in the U.S., mostly in Muslim families. Rare, luminous, and meaning-clear.
